I don't think its incredibly random. At least not completely. There are patterns that match social and personal precepts and these patterns follow any number of varying elements. For instance, the title itself. If its a simple title, using bold strong words, this can create interest because it feels easier to access. Titles with too many words are sometimes off-putting, or titles that don't make sense or even titles with subjects that don't interest people for any number of reasons. Another aspect would be the poster themselves. Is it someone you like talking with? Someone who annoys the crap out of you and you'd prefer avoiding or know they have nothing interesting to contribute? Is it someone you enjoy trolling? Then again there is the subject of the thread itself. A persons mood on a specific day or point in time can determine whether they care or not, perhaps the thread does not allow them to post something utilizing their ego and so they'd prefer not getting involved.
